Little update:

Trying to "fix" this campaign is hard.  Also, trying to think of practical line-of-sight blockers is also hard.  Simply adding trees won't help much with spawning.

 

I got up until the crescendo event in the first map.  The campy corner is blocked off a bit so there isn't much to run back and hide behind once you start the event, so there is a bigger chance for a death charge to take place.  The second floor of the store is also blocked off as well as it's a very campy spot.
